图形数据库

在Neo4j中探索、管理、存储和分析图形数据®数据库使用MATLAB®接口到Neo4j或用于Neo4j Bolt协议的Database Toolbox™接口

Database Toolbox允许您使用到Neo4j的MATLAB接口连接到一个Neo4j图形数据库。在创建一个Neo4j连接之后,您可以搜索图形数据库数据。在数据库中创建、更新和删除节点和关系。更新节点标签和属性以及更新关系属性。利用MATLAB有向图对图形网络算法进行分析。将有向图存储在Neo4j数据库中。通过执行Cypher遍历和分析图形数据®使用Cypher查询语言的查询。

您还可以使用Bolt协议连接到Neo4j数据库。您可以使用相同的功能与存储在Neo4j数据库中的图形数据进行交互。要使用Bolt协议进行连接,必须安装用于Neo4j Bolt协议的数据库工具箱接口

功能

全部展开

neo4j 连接到Neo4j数据库
关闭 关闭Neo4j数据库连接
nodeDegree 的每个关联关系类型的“入度”和“出度”Neo4j数据库节点
nodeLabels 所有节点标签Neo4j数据库
nodeRelationTypes 关联的关系类型Neo4j数据库节点
neo4jStruct2Digraph 转换图形或关系结构Neo4j数据库到有向图
propertyKeys 所有属性键Neo4j数据库
relationTypes 所有关系类型Neo4j数据库
searchGraph 搜索子图或整个图Neo4j数据库
searchNode 搜索Neo4j按标签或按属性键和值划分的数据库节点
searchNodeByID 搜索Neo4j由节点标识符数据库节点
searchRelation 搜索关系Neo4j数据库节点
searchRelationByID 搜索Neo4j按关系标识符
createNode 在创建节点Neo4j数据库
createRelation 在其中的节点之间创建关系Neo4j数据库
deleteNode 删除节点从Neo4j数据库
deleteRelation 删除关系从Neo4j数据库
addNodeLabel 向其中的节点添加标签Neo4j数据库
removeNodeLabel 从节点删除标签Neo4j数据库
removeNodeProperty 从在节点中删除属性Neo4j数据库
removeRelationProperty 从关系中删除属性Neo4j数据库
setNodeProperty 为其中的节点设置属性Neo4j数据库
setRelationProperty 为关系设置属性Neo4j数据库
updateNode 更新节点标签和属性Neo4j数据库
updateRelation 在更新关系属性Neo4j数据库
storeDigraph 商店向图Neo4j数据库
executeCypher 执行数字查询Neo4j数据库

对象

Neo4jConnect Neo4j数据库连接
Neo4jNode Neo4j数据库节点
Neo4jRelation Neo4j数据库的关系

主题

关于Neo4j数据库接口

图形化Neo4j数据库接口的数据库工作流程

发现Neo4j图形数据库并探索Neo4j数据库接口和工作流。

数据库工具箱界面Neo4j的螺栓安装协议

安装用于Neo4j Bolt协议的数据库工具箱接口并了解所支持的Neo4j数据库版本。万博1manbetx

浏览和更新图表

搜索图数据库

进行一般或有针对性的搜索。

探索图形数据库结构

遍历图形数据库结构。

更新社交社区的好友信息

在Neo4j数据库中创建、更新和删除节点和关系。

图表数据使用分析MATLAB有向图对象

确定的服务依存关系网络

执行图形网络分析以查找依赖项。

找出社会邻居之间的最短路径

执行图形网络分析以确定最短路径。

在社交圈里找朋友的朋友

执行图形网络分析来确定后继节点。

添加和查询社会邻居中的同事组

将有向图存储在Neo4j数据库中,然后对结果图执行Cypher查询。

故障排除

对Neo4j的数据库接口错误信息

处理Neo4j数据库的错误消息、到Neo4j的MATLAB接口和用于Neo4j Bolt协议的数据库工具箱接口